Two restoration trends amongst Christchurch renovations: replicating old colours and integrating mirrors. 

Builders didn’t have a very comprehensive paint chart to work with 200 years ago, but our current technologies allow us to replicate these colours pretty well! Terracotta reds, butter yellows, browns, and greens - these are popular heritage colours that can re-establish the authentic character of your home.

As for integrating mirrors, it’s not trending solely for the purpose you might think (creating the illusion of vaster space). Rather, it’s to combat the cold, wet, and windy nature of Christchurch weather. As many heritage homes lack big windows that are popular today, adding large mirrors to areas lacking direct sunlight helps to create a warm, bright ambience in the home year-round.

How much will my home renovation cost?

For example, smaller-scale projects focusing on basic improvements, such as replacing a dormer window, can cost around $8,000*. While in contrast, larger-scale projects, like recladding the house’s entire exterior, can cost between $30,000* to $35,000+*.

Will Refresh take care of any required council consent? 

Before the renovation begins, we will dive into the historical significance of your home and surrounding areas. If your home is of heritage significance, it could be protected under local or national laws. 

For these cases, specific permits are required by the city or district council before renovations can begin. Sounds confusing? Don’t worry; we’ll do it all for you.
